Refinery29 Countdown Videos by Ami Kealoha

Refinery29, our favorite co-conspirators in fashion, today launched Countdown, their series of online videos visiting top designers in their studios in the days leading up to New York's upcoming fashion week. The inaugural episode takes a look at duo Vena Cava who were recently nominated for the CFDA/Vogue fashion award, sneaking a peak at their upcoming collection and design process. With Alexander Wang, Rag & Bone, Jeremy Laing, Karen Walker and a wrap-up featuring footage from their shows coming up—all set to a swoon-worthy soundtrack—we're excited to tune-in over the next few weeks.
